Manchester United returned to the Champions League with a 4–0 victory over Azerbaijan’s Sabah at Old Trafford on September 10, 2026, scoring three times before half-time.

Matheus Cunha opened the scoring from a Patrick Dorgu cross. Bruno Fernandes then finished a move involving Cunha and Youri Tielemans before Benjamin Sesko rounded the goalkeeper to give United a commanding interval lead, according to The Guardian’s match report.

Lisandro Martínez added the fourth late in the second half after a United free-kick caused confusion in the visitors’ defence. Sabah had threatened before the break, with Joy-Lance Mickels heading wide from a Kaheem Parris cross while the match was still closer.

The game marked Sabah’s Champions League debut and United’s return to the competition after a two-year absence. Michael Carrick’s side controlled the second half, while Mason Mount came on at the interval for his first appearance of the season.

The result gives United a win ahead of their next Premier League meeting with Manchester City, following a draw at Everton in their previous league match.
